Greater New Orleans, Inc. is the nonprofit regional economic development organization serving the 10-parish Greater New Orleans region. Our mission is to create a region with a thriving economy and an excellent quality of life, for everyone. The ultimate indication of our success will be the presence of a robust, accessible, and growing middle class in Southeast Louisiana where our children and grandchildren can live and prosper.
 
The Business Engagement Director plays an essential support role in engaging GNO, Inc.’s corporate investors and other priority regional businesses in GNO, Inc.’s target sectors. As such, the Business Engagement Director will support the Senior Vice President of Advancement, as well as the Vice President of Growth and Retention. This role requires knowledge of fundamental sales or fundraising principles, excellent communication skills, and high attention to detail.
 
In addition to the specific duties of the Business Engagement Director detailed below, GNO, Inc. operates with a cross-functional mentality. It is a job with both significant responsibility and reward and is an opportunity to play an important role in the economic future of the Greater New Orleans region. The Business Engagement Director reports to the Senior Vice President of Advancement.
 
Job Responsibilities
- Develop deep familiarity with Greater New Orleans businesses, particularly GNO, Inc. investors, and how their interests correlate to GNO, Inc.’s day‐to‐day work and long‐term priorities
- Act as the internal lead for GNO, Inc. corporate investor engagement, monitoring involvement in GNO, Inc. and helping to provide value that supports business stability and growth
- Meet with an average of 4-5 businesses each week, comprised of GNO, Inc. investors and other priority regional businesses in GNO, Inc.’s target sectors; coordinate necessary follow-up action items with the appropriate GNO, Inc. staffers
- Develop a pipeline of prospective GNO, Inc. investors, working closely with the Sr. VP of Advancement and other GNO, Inc. staff members to cultivate and expand the GNO, Inc. investor base
- Function as one of GNO, Inc.’s CRM (Salesforce) leads, supporting and guiding effective use of the system for tracking business engagement
- On occasion, assist the VP of Business Retention & Growth with project management for retention and expansion projects
- Play an integral role in GNO, Inc. communications to maximize business engagement, including:
    - Management and execution of GNO, Inc. investor communications and maintaining a calendar of events; actively seeking opportunities to highlight and engage GNO, Inc. investors
    - Coordination with GNO, Inc. communications staff to highlight relevant announcements from GNO, Inc. investors on social media channels
- Support the development, solicitation, and fulfillment of sponsorship benefits for GNO, Inc. signature events as a function of business engagement

GNO, Inc. is the regional economic development organization for Southeast Louisiana. GNO, Inc.'s mission is to create a Greater New Orleans with a thriving economy and an excellent quality of life, for everyone.


To achieve this goal, GNO, Inc. pursues a two-pronged strategy:

  • Business Development – Attract, retain, and develop the businesses that will employ our future workforce and drive our economy forward
  • Business Environment – Propose, promote, and facilitate policies and programs that improve the overall conditions under which businesses operate

GNO, Inc. works together with the business community; local, state, and federal governments; and other regional stakeholders to coordinate, consolidate, and catalyze action on key issues and opportunities that maximize job and wealth creation and retention, are relevant to the region as a whole, and create systematic impact.


From workforce development and fiscal reform to coastal stabilization and criminal justice reform, when we pool our efforts toward mutually beneficial outcomes, we can produce a whole that is greater than the sum of its parts.
